Comment gérer un stepper avec des boutons M/A, Plus vite, moins vite, inversion du sens de rotation le tout avec des rampes

Portrait de Spy

Le mot de passe est disponible par une demande dans Contact

Portrait de meuh

Salut Spy , je n ai pas encore pu regarder ton dernier soft en détail mais déjà je le trouve très bien commenter et l explication des moteur  PAP ....Bravo  

Je vais approfondir tous ça dés que possible ! Noël arrive a grand pas et les dernieres courses aussi !!!

A+

Portrait de RichardV

Bonjour

Bravo pour le petit tuto sur l'interface TB6600.

J'ai effectué le montage mais est normal que le moteur se mette a tourner à la mise sous tension? si oui y a t-il moyen de modifier ce mode de fonctionnement.

Est il possible de mettre un BP qui permet de faire tourner le moteur en PAS par PAS (1 pas , très petite tempo et 1 autre pas; ainsi de suite en maintenant appuyé le BP)

Encore bravo et très bon TUTO parce que je ne connaissait pas cette interface très pratique

Merci d'avance

Portrait de Spy

Pour ne pas faire tourner le moteur au démarrage il suffit de remplacer la ligne :

digitalWrite(Ena1, LOW); // Activation de la rotation du stepper

Par

digitalWrite(Ena1, HIGH); // Désactivation de la rotation du stepper.

Pour ce qui est du pas à pas il faut modifier pas mal de lignes du programme et comme je n'en vois pas l'intérêt je n'irai pas plus loin, mais tu peux le faire, sachant que le moteur restera sous tension en permanence ce qui implique consommation et échauffement du moteur, mais c'est tout à fait réalisable

Portrait de RichardV

Merci pour la réponse

Pourtant j'ai chercher de nombreuses heures et c'était si simple

Merci encore